The Junior Aftercare & Warranty Administrator will provide day-to-day administrative support to the Aftersales department. This role plays an essential part in ensuring smooth coordination of warranty processes, customer support activities, and logistics for aftercare operations. The successful candidate will assist with order processing, shipping documentation, supplier returns, and system updates to maintain accurate and timely records across all warranty and aftercare functions.
Key Responsibilities:
Administrative Support
Assist with daily administrative tasks for the Aftercare and Warranty program.
Maintain organized records, correspondence, and documentation related to vessel warranty cases.
Support communication with customers, suppliers, and logistics partners as required.
Orders & Shipments
Prepare and process purchase orders for warranty replacements and aftercare parts.
Track outgoing and incoming shipments, ensuring accuracy and timely delivery.
Coordinate with logistics providers and assist with preparation of shipping and customs documentation.
Supplier Returns
Assist in managing supplier return processes for faulty or replacement parts.
Maintain accurate records of returned goods, credit notes, and replacement shipments.
Follow up with suppliers to ensure timely resolution and feedback.
Warranty & Tracker Updates
Update warranty trackers and internal databases with claim statuses, parts orders, and shipment progress.
Ensure all relevant information is logged and accurately maintained for reporting and traceability.
Assist with compiling weekly and monthly reports as required.
